Inquiry into food pricing and food security in remote Indigenous communities – Submission number 101
On Thursday, 21 May 2020, the Minister for Indigenous Australians, the Hon Ken Wyatt MP, asked the Standing Committee on Indigenous Affairs to inquire into and report on food prices and food security in remote Indigenous communities. PHAI’s provided a submission which can be found on the inquiry website as Submission Number 101.

Food & Beverages Advertising Code Review: AANA discussion paper for public comment
The Australian Association of National Advertisers (AANA) is reviewing the Food & Beverages Advertising Code to ensure it is still fit for purpose. PHAI responded to the discussion paper. You can read our response here.
